N2 - This paper presents a stochastic Newton method to compute the switching angles in multilevel converters so as to produce the required fundamental voltage while at the same time not generate higher order harmonics. For Newton method, a good initial guess which should be very close to exact solution patterns is necessary, so using stochastic techniques gives a new way to find possible initial values, such as the beginning process of particle swarm optimization (PSO). This synthetic method is called stochastic Newton method (SNM), which is applied to multilevel inverters with any number of levels. All sets of solutions are found for eleven and nineteen levels converters to show the simplicity, effectiveness, and easy implementation of SNM.
